Output 0caf3af8eb8127d892912f8f98ac3da03264244fffcdc9b56c6731a98683e3bb:0

value
10949100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6f23d2fa3b214ca8ca5fcd10e88b9717b4f786d OP_EQUAL
address
3QCkLo5xP5h2hPZNRAyRWgTuq2x3UBCZng
transaction
0caf3af8eb8127d892912f8f98ac3da03264244fffcdc9b56c6731a98683e3bb
confirmations
415212
spent
true